Read This Before Scheduling A Baby Photography Wokingham Shoot

Most parents get too excited when searching for newborn photography Berkshire services, particularly if it is their first time to have their baby’s photos taken by a professional. Such photos will be an outstanding remembrance of that significant moment that you can proudly display in your home. However, these kinds of scheduled sessions aren’t that easy and will require planning and time.

Listed below are several tips on how parents should prepare, not only themselves, but also their newborns before getting that photoshoot.

1. Outfits and accessories

You’d want your little one to look charming in those photographs, and that’s why you must prepare adorable costumes for the baby photography Wokingham session. When choosing a costume for your little one, be sure to include lots of neutral and soft colours. This is because striking and dark colours can cast shadows on the infant’s skin, which will be tricky to edit afterwards. Photographers usually provide accessories to clients for the session. However, using personal belongings as accessories can give your images more uniqueness, such as small playthings, heirlooms, or scarves knitted by their grandparents.

2. A nice place with a warm temperature

A warm temperature is crucial to make your baby feel at ease and fall asleep faster, making photoshoots much smoother to carry out. Providers of newborn photography Berkshire services figure out the optimal temperature for your little one so they can set it up in their studio before you get there. If you wish to have the photoshoot in your household, tweak the temperature to a warm 80 degrees around 30 minutes before the session to ensure total comfort for your baby.

3. Participate in the session!

Newborn photoshoots don’t automatically mean letting your baby pose on their own facing a camera. If you want, you can also be part of the session and cuddle with your child. Carrying your child in your arms will let them feel less aggravated and more relaxed.

Furthermore, the photographer will capture your fondness for your newborn in the pictures. Brainstorming for various poses with your partner and photographer can make the photoshoot more interesting and lively. Just wear outfits with plain colours and with no patterns to make your baby stand out in the photos.

4. Feed your newborn ahead of time

A hungry newborn might be aggravated throughout a baby photography Wokingham session, and you clearly do not want an angry face to be taken by the photographer. Never forget that your aim here is to make your little one cosy as much as you can. Because of this, you must feed your little one ahead of the photoshoot to ensure that they will stay asleep without interruption. In case they wake up and cry, photographers may give some cuddling time, quick meals and potty breaks so you can calm down your newborn. It is also not a bad plan to check that the photographer you’re hiring is well-versed in taking care of babies in photoshoots.
